Understanding HS Codes
The Harmonized System, developed and maintained by the World Customs Organization (WCO), is a standardized numerical method used to classify traded products. This system forms the foundation for customs tariffs and international trade statistics worldwide.
HS codes typically consist of six digits, with the first two digits representing the chapter, the next two indicating the heading, and the last two specifying the subheading. Countries may add additional digits for further specificity in their national tariff schedules.
HS Codes for Steel Ingots
Steel ingots, as a primary form of raw steel, fall under Chapter 72 of the HS code, which covers "Iron and Steel." The specific HS code for steel ingots can vary depending on the exact composition and intended use. Here are some relevant HS codes for steel ingots used in industrial applications:
- 7206.10: Ingots of iron and non-alloy steel
- 7218.10: Ingots of stainless steel
- 7224.10: Ingots of other alloy steel
These codes are crucial for accurately classifying steel ingots in international trade, ensuring proper tariff assessment and compliance with trade regulations.
Importance of Correct HS Code Classification
Proper classification of steel ingots under the correct HS code is vital for several reasons:
- Tariff Determination: HS codes directly impact the duties and taxes applied to imported goods.
- Trade Statistics: Accurate classification contributes to reliable global trade data.
- Regulatory Compliance: Correct HS codes ensure adherence to trade agreements and restrictions.
- Supply Chain Efficiency: Proper coding facilitates smoother customs clearance processes.
Misclassification can lead to delays, fines, and other legal complications, underscoring the importance of accurate HS code assignment for steel ingots and other raw metal imports.
Factors Influencing HS Code Selection for Steel Ingots
When determining the appropriate HS code for steel ingots, several factors come into play:
- Composition: The specific alloy content of the steel ingot
- Production Method: How the ingot was manufactured (e.g., electric furnace, basic oxygen furnace)
- Intended Use: Whether the ingot is for general industrial use or specialized applications
- Form and Dimensions: The shape and size of the ingot
These factors can influence which specific HS code is most appropriate for a given shipment of steel ingots.

Challenges in HS Code Classification for Steel Ingots
Despite the standardized nature of HS codes, classifying steel ingots can present challenges:
- Alloy Complexity: The wide range of steel alloys can make it difficult to determine the most appropriate HS code.
- Technological Advancements: New steel production methods may not fit neatly into existing HS code categories.
- Dual-Use Concerns: Some steel ingots may have both civilian and military applications, complicating their classification.
- Regional Variations: Different countries may interpret HS codes for steel ingots slightly differently.
Navigating these challenges requires expertise in both the steel industry and international trade regulations.
